Dream Interiors | Making the House cozy for Autumn!

How do you do it? Ive been reading some articles and I'm making a plan!  Revolving around this palette...




My living room is closer to that light blue... Currently I have lots of summer colours - pinks and yellows...

I read through this guide on Womans Guide and the tips are...






"
1. Stack a couple of wood logs by the fireplace.   - i dont have a fireplace
2. Toss a chenille throw across the end of the sofa. - i already have a white throw
3. Display branches gathered from your backyard in a tall glass vase.- I can change my spring blooms!
4. Replace white and beige lampshades with deeper hues, like chocolate, bronze or gold-edged black. - in a turquoise room?
5. Place potted mums or other flowers in autumn leaf colors (think orange, red, amber) on the mantel or coffee table.   Yes!!
6. Put a basket full of squash, baby pumpkins, acorns and pinecones on the kitchen table. - not practical
7. Paint the insides of bookcases a warm shade of burnt sienna or moss green. - no! I love my white bookcases "

Free Download | Printable Meal Planner

Of course we all love Olli Blog for providing free twitter backgrounds... well here we have a recipe planner thats been around for a while!! If you remember my post about the dry wipe board... 

Another fun freebie from Alma Loveland: a graphic you can download, print, and frame under glass in your kitchen, then use a dry erase marker to write your meal plans on it. The print will fit in a standard IKEA Ribba frame, or you can scale it to a smaller size if you prefer. - Originally seen on How About Orange.

Eco Love | For The Home Plover Organic



PLOVER Organic bedding is both designed exquisitely and earth friendly. Named after the endangered shorebird, Plover is dedicated to offering 100% organic textiles.
